While reviewing [1], I and Amit noticed that a flag ParallelMessagePending is 
defined
as "volatile bool", but other flags set by signal handlers are defined as 
"volatile sig_atomic_t".

The datatype has been defined in standard C,
and it says that variables referred by signal handlers should be "volatile 
sig_atomic_t".
(Please see my observation [2])

This may be not needed because any failures had been reported,
but I thought their datatype should be same and attached a small patch.
